A Tale of Two Talented Actors
Ruth and Philip's story is a testament to the power of talent and the bonds it can forge. Both hailing from Wales, they met and married, creating a dynamic duo in the world of acting. Philip, known for his villainous roles, left an impression on audiences with his performance in Dad's Army, inspiring one of the show's most memorable moments. His versatility was on full display, from The Avengers to Doctor Who, where he showcased his range as an actor.
A Lasting Legacy
Despite their divorce in 1981, Ruth and Philip's connection endured. They remained close, united by their shared love for the industry and their family. Ruth's heartfelt reflection on Philip's talent and their shared memories is a beautiful testament to their relationship. Even after their split, they continued to support each other, a rare and admirable dynamic.
